Conquering Saving Strategies: Make Every Dollar Count

Building a solid financial foundation begins with effective saving strategies. It's about cultivating mindful spending habits and strategically allocating your resources. By implementing a few key principles, you can boost your savings potential and achieve your financial goals.

  • Identify your financial goals: What are you storing for? A down payment on a dwelling? Retirement? Identifying your objectives will influence your saving strategies.
  • Establish a budget: A well-structured budget is crucial for scrutinizing your income and expenses. It enables you to distribute funds wisely and pinpoint areas where you can reduce spending.
  • Schedule your savings: Set up automatic transfers from your checking account to your savings fund. This ensures consistent saving, even when life gets demanding.

Remember that every dollar saved is a step toward financial stability. By implementing these saving strategies, you can modify your relationship with money and build a brighter financial future.

Budgeting Basics: Taking Control of Your Finances

Taking charge of your finances can seem daunting, but it doesn't have to be. Formulating a budget is the first step towards achieving your financial goals. A well-crafted budget allows you to monitor your income and expenses, identify areas where you can save, and assign your funds wisely. By utilizing a budgeting strategy, you gain a clear understanding of your financial situation and empower yourself to make intelligent decisions about your money.

  • Begin by listing all sources of income.
  • Group your expenses into necessary and non-essential categories.
  • Establish realistic spending limits for each category.
  • Review your budget regularly and make adjustments as needed.
